## Tuning the autoscaler

The Quellis autoscaler scales workers on queue depth, not CPU. It
samples depth on a fixed interval, applies a smoothing window, and only
acts when the smoothed value crosses a threshold for the full hold
period. This prevents flapping during deploys, when queues briefly
spike. Release managers should confirm these values match the staging
config before promoting a build, since drift here is the most common
rollout failure. The shipped defaults are:

tuning table, yajog-yahof:
BUDGETS = {
    "lamvan": 303,
    "wenox": 460,
    "fenvan": 525,
}

Ticket: Staging env misconfigured for Siftgate bloom filter

The bloom layer in front of the Pellet KV store is rejecting all lookups in staging because the env file was copied from the dev template without credentials. False-positive tuning values are fine; only the auth line is missing. To unblock the weekly demo, the Pellet admission secret must be set on the following line.

env line for yaguf-fajop: LEDGER_TOKEN13=fb08984397349

- [ ] Step 7: Archive cold storage buckets (Glacierline tier). Confirm both ceremony witnesses are present, verify bucket manifests match the Oxbow ledger, then seal the archive key shares. Plugin authors may observe but not handle shares. Once sealed, the archive index itself is encrypted and can only be reopened with the passphrase below.

vault phrase of badup-hahig = tamael-aldael-kelmir-istael-fenok-istwyn-tamius-jorath-oliion

## Data Stores: Search Relevance Tuning

The Quillmark platform keeps relevance tuning data in two places. Synonym maps and boost weights live in the ranking store; click-through feedback lands in the metrics warehouse nightly. New team members should only edit weights through the Tunebench UI, never directly. For read-only inspection of the ranking store, connect with the string below.

primary connection of yagep-kahip = redis://giliel_svc:zYiKsLL2PLpfPL@db-348f.xolmarsys.corp:5432/fenwyn